## Version 0.7.0
### Changes in default behavior
- Increased default collision cache to 50 in RobotWorld.
- Changed `CSpaceConfig.position_limit_clip` default to 0 as previous default of 0.01 can make
default start state in examples be out of bounds.
- MotionGen uses parallel_finetune by default. To get previous motion gen behavior, pass
`warmup(parallel_finetune=False)` and `MotionGenPlanConfig(parallel_finetune=False)`.
- MotionGen loads Mesh Collision checker instead of Primitive by default.
- UR10e and UR5e now don't have a collision sphere at tool frame for world collision checking. This
sphere is only active for self collision avoidance.
- With torch>=2.0, cuRobo will use `torch.compile` instead of `torch.jit.script` to generate fused
kernels. This can take several seconds during the first run. To enable this feature, set
environment variable `export CUROBO_TORCH_COMPILE_DISABLE=0`.

### Performance Regressions
- cuRobo now generates significantly shorter paths then previous version. E.g., cuRobo obtains
2.2 seconds 98th percentile motion time on the 2600 problems (`benchmark/curobo_benchmark.py`),
where previously it was at 3 seconds (1.36x quicker motions). This was obtained by retuning the
weights and slight reformulations of trajectory optimization. These changes have led to a slight
degrade in planning time, 20ms slower on 4090 and 40ms on ORIN MAXN. We will address this slow down
in a later release. One way to avoid this regression is to set `finetune_dt_scale=1.05` in
`MotionGenConfig.load_from_robot_config()`.
